Question NW1107 to the Minister of Trade and Industry
22 June 2020 - NW1107
Cuthbert, Mr MJ to ask the Minister of Trade and Industry
(1)Whether, with reference to his reply to question 259 on 25 May 2020, he will furnish Mr M.J Cuthbert with the (a) names and (b) job titles of each employee of his department who has been on sabbatical leave since 1 January 2019; if not, in each case, why not; if so, what are the relevant details in each case; (2) whether any of the specified employees have subsequently applied for an additional period of sabbatical leave; if so, what are the relevant details of the additional period of leave (a) requested and (b) granted in each case? [NW1403E]
Reply:
I have requested the additional information and am advised as follows:
1. The names and the job titles of the relevant employees as per question 259 on 25 May 2020 who have taken sabbatical leave since 1 January 2019 and the details are as follows:

(2) None of the employees have subsequently applied for an additional period of sabbatical leave.
